Output 32c7373fcfb66b3a7c12bdfaa10475304a5f5201047653dc9bc3330d55a203ea:42

value
2842746
script pubkey
OP_0 OP_PUSHBYTES_20 de19e8cc6d5be0bd3b2b27e71b992b2eed16a69a
address
bc1qmcv73nrdt0st6wetyln3hxft9mk3df56e7duzv
transaction
32c7373fcfb66b3a7c12bdfaa10475304a5f5201047653dc9bc3330d55a203ea